Backflow preventer installation services involve setting up specialized devices designed to protect potable water supplies from contamination caused by reverse flow. These devices are installed at critical points within a property's plumbing system to ensure that used or contaminated water cannot flow back into the main water supply. Proper installation requires understanding the specific plumbing layout and selecting the appropriate backflow prevention device to match the property's needs. This service helps maintain safe drinking water and complies with local plumbing codes and regulations.
One of the primary issues backflow preventers address is the risk of pollutants, such as bacteria, chemicals, or debris, entering the clean water supply due to pressure changes or cross-connections. Without a backflow prevention device, contaminants from irrigation systems, industrial processes, or even household plumbing could siphon back into the main water line, posing health hazards. Installing a backflow preventer provides a reliable barrier, reducing the likelihood of water contamination and ensuring the safety of the property's water supply for residents and occupants.
Properties that typically utilize backflow preventer installation services include residential homes, commercial buildings, industrial facilities, and institutions such as schools or hospitals. Residential properties with irrigation systems or private wells often require these devices to prevent garden or well water from mixing with drinking water lines. Commercial and industrial properties, especially those with complex plumbing systems or processes involving chemicals, rely heavily on backflow prevention to meet safety standards and prevent costly contamination issues. The overview below groups typical Backflow Preventer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Wapakoneta, OH.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Installation Costs - The cost to install a backflow preventer typically ranges from $150 to $500, depending on the system size and complexity. For example, a standard residential unit might cost around $200 to $300 for installation services.
Material Expenses - The price of backflow preventer units can vary from $50 to $300, influenced by the type and quality of the device. Basic models are usually more affordable, while specialized or commercial-grade units tend to cost more.
Labor Fees - Labor charges for installing a backflow preventer generally fall between $100 and $400. Factors affecting costs include accessibility and local labor rates in Wapakoneta, OH.
Maintenance and Inspection - Routine inspections and maintenance services may cost between $50 and $150 annually. Proper upkeep can help ensure the device functions correctly and prevents costly repairs later.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
